Find the area of a regular hexagon with the given measurement. 4-inch side A = sq. in. Please show work.

Answer:


A=41.58(inches)^2

Explanation:

Given: The side of the regular hexagon measures 4 inches.

To find: The area of the regular hexagon.

Solution: The area of the regular hexagon can be found as:


A=(3√(3))/(2)(side)^2


A=(3√(3))/(2)(4)^2


A=(3√(3))/(2)(16)


A=24√(3)


A=41.58(inches)^2

Thus, the area of the regular hexagon will be equal to
41.58 (inches)^2.
